Acrylic Bathtub

In case you’re searching for a bathtub choice and inching toward an acrylic bathtub. Well, to begin with, it is made from vacuum-formed acrylic sheets. The acrylic bathtub is designed from these sheets being molded and placed together. 

The typical association of acrylic bathtubs is with the durability and ease of cleaning nature. Not only acrylic bathtubs for a broader comparison between acrylic VS fiberglass tubs. Acrylic tubs come in a range of options with varying shapes and designs. The ease of maintaining acrylic bathtubs free from any forms of rust acrylic bathtub has become widely popular in most bathroom decors.

Fiberglass Bathtub

A fiberglass bathtub is made from fiber-reinforced plastic and is molded into the shape of a tub. A fiberglass bathtub is typically made out of a single piece of material. In terms of the different shapes and features, a fiberglass bathtub offers the same durability and design as an acrylic bathtub. 

While the key difference lies in the weight. A fiberglass bathtub is much lighter than its acrylic counterparts. The key component going in favor of acrylic bathtubs is the fact it takes a long time before corrosion starts. Due to the material components of the fiber-reinforced plastic. Homes in humid areas have a particular inkling towards fiberglass bathtubs. The substance material results in the designs looking barely old even after prolonged use.

Cost Between the Two

The cost of an acrylic bathtub is higher in comparison to a fiberglass tub. The longevity of the acrylic bathtub along with the shine of the design is great and eye-catching. Top-tier hotels usually prefer acrylic bathtubs. They last for years and give off the impression of a certain aesthetic glamor. 

The fiberglass tub is popular on the other owing to the ease of maintenance and affordable costs. The fiberglass tub is more like the everyday middle-class model where after easy installation there is no fret of maintenance. 

Maintaining the Tub

To talk about the maintenance of acrylic VS fiberglass tub, one must note both are a great fit for everyday home use. For the sake of being specific owing to the materials, an acrylic bathtub is slightly difficult to clean and maintain. 

The fiberglass tub has material with softer textures in comparison and therefore provides easier cleaning. There is also thought due to the smooth texture that the fiberglass tub is easily scratched. 

Longevity

In theory, to talk about the longevity of fiberglass VS acrylic tubs, fiberglass has a greater life guarantee. If you have kids in your house, the acrylic bathtub is probably the way to go. The high melting point coupled with the fact that the tensile strength is greater than that of fiberglass tubs makes it less susceptible to damage. 

The more rough everyday use is, the more inclination should be towards acrylic. The fiberglass tub is equally good but fiberglass generally excels in areas not put into rough use.

Weight of the Material

The weight of the material in the conversation between fiberglass VS acrylic tub tilts greatly in the favor of fiberglass. If your primary importance out of the options between acrylic VS fiberglass tub is the easiest way of installing then fiberglass is the option to choose.

Fiberglass tubs are amongst the lightest weight available in the market. It is certainly much less in weight than an acrylic bathtub. 

Pros and Cons of Acrylic VS Fiberglass Tub

The brief pros and cons of both fiberglass VS acrylic tubs can make your decision of final choice. 

Fiberglass Tub

The main advantage of fiberglass tubs is the cost, affordability, and ease of installation. The fiberglass tub is lightweight and it is easy to install and placed anywhere in accordance with the washroom. Repairing a fiberglass tub is also very easy to do. 

Amongst the disadvantages, a fiberglass tub has a much shorter life span and performs poorly if you are using warm water every other alternate day in the bath. It is not heat resistant. 

Acrylic Bathtub

The acrylic bathtub can hold on to the shine of the design if maintained properly for years. They are resistant to heat and therefore perform well if you are using warm waters. The hard surface of the materials makes acrylic less vulnerable to scratches and cracks. 

The disadvantages are of course that fiberglass tubs are much more affordable. Acrylic has a much higher price cost. The weight of an acrylic bathtub is also quite heavy in comparison.

Frequently Asked Questions: 

Q.1) How much does a standard-size acrylic tub weigh against fiberglass?

The standard size of an acrylic tub to that fiberglass is 100 pounds for acrylic tubs while 70 pounds for fiberglass. 

Q.2) Do acrylic tubs crack easily?

No, due to the non-porous element of acrylic, the bathtub won’t be absorbing water. The material acrylic is also strong and therefore resistant to scratches and cracks.
